Economists state Azerbaijan's interest in new trade corridors between Russia and Georgia

The project on transit corridor through Abkhazia and South Ossetia is beneficial to Azerbaijan, as well as to other countries of the region, experts interviewed by the "Caucasian Knot" believe.

On May 24, in Prague, negotiations were held of Grigory Karasin, Russia's Deputy Foreign Minister, with Zurab Abashidze, Special Representative of Georgia's Prime Minister. They had agreed to form a working group to implement the 2011 intergovernmental agreement on setting up trade corridors across the territories of Abkhazia and South Ossetia.

The project is of special interest for Armenia, Togrul Djuvarly, a member of the Azerbaijani National Public Committee for European Integration, believes.

"Armenia hopes, through the opening of the corridor across Abkhazia, to get out of the railway blockade, which it had created itself because of the conflict with Azerbaijan and the absence of relations with Turkey," the expert believes.

However, the opening of corridors to Armenia may cause some problems in Baku-Tbilisi relationships, Mr Djuvarly said. Baku has done much for the economic development and energy supply to Georgia over the past 20 years, and, of course, it would like Tbilisi making steps to lift the economic blockade from Armenia, with which Azerbaijan is at war, the expert has explained.

Natig Djafarly, a member of the Mejlis of the Republican Alternative (ReAl) Party, has noted that Azerbaijan is critical of the plans to open a Russia-Georgia railway communication via Abkhazia. This corridor is beneficial to Armenia, which will direct part of its economic dividends to strengthen its army and will further tighten its position at negotiations on the Karabakh settlement, Mr Djafarly told the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ent.

Thanks to the opening of trade corridors across Abkhazia and South Ossetia, Azerbaijan will be able to increase the volume of cargo transportation by the Baku-Tbilisi-Kars (BTK) railway, Ilham Shaban, the head of the "Caspian Barrel" Oil Research Centre, has stated. The more cargo, the sooner Azerbaijan will payback the BTK construction, since the building costs in the territory of Georgia were covered by Azerbaijan, the expert said.
